Output e26e4c57679ca298e25af3043ae0d34c61398aef789f538c9911ed9d0b5306e5:2

value
3483411
script pubkey
OP_0 OP_PUSHBYTES_32 d4eeb16878794660158b87cbab8a8f25b3ede7eac27b5375444eff8489e97091
address
bc1q6nhtz6rc09rxq9vtsl96hz50yke7mel2cfa4xa2yfmlcfz0fwzgs66wcud
transaction
e26e4c57679ca298e25af3043ae0d34c61398aef789f538c9911ed9d0b5306e5
confirmations
156990
spent
true